Different cryptocurrencies have differences in network fees. For example, higher network congestion can lead to increased fees for currencies like Ethereum. Bitcoin also experiences fee increases when the network is busy.
Simple transfers usually have lower fees, while complex transactions such as smart contract calls and token swaps incur higher fees. This is especially evident when performing specific operations with the Bitpie wallet.
The real-time fluctuations of the cryptocurrency market can affect the setting of transaction fees. For example, when there is major news or market volatility, users need to adjust their choice of transaction fees according to the actual situation.
Bitpie Wallet allows users to choose transaction fees based on the current network load and their personal needs, which also affects the actual payment cost. During periods of network congestion, some users may choose to pay higher fees to speed up transaction processing.
The network load varies at different times. For example, during periods of active trading, transaction fees are usually higher than during off-peak times. This is especially important when transferring large amounts of funds.
Observe the market's active hours and try to complete transactions during off-peak periods to save on transaction fees.
Users can freely adjust the transaction fee in the Bitpie wallet according to their actual needs. When a transaction does not require urgent confirmation, a lower fee can be selected.
Always keep an eye on the congestion of cryptocurrency networks so that you can better seize the optimal trading opportunities and ensure that transaction fees are minimized.
